Abstract

A kind of earthnut sheller with grading function, including shell, the horizontal conveyer belt being equipped with for placing peanut in the shell, shell side are equipped with the entrance passed through for conveyer belt, and the other side is equipped with the outlet passed through for conveyer belt, and the conveyer belt is filter structure;Direction of the lower surface of conveyer belt from entrance to outlet is equipped at intervals with the first backing plate, the second backing plate and third backing plate, conveyer belt top, which is equipped with, to be moved up and down and rotatable first pressing plate, the second pressing plate and third pressing plate, first pressing plate, the second pressing plate and third pressing plate are corresponded with the first backing plate, the second backing plate and third backing plate respectively;Rewinding box is equipped with below conveyer belt between first backing plate and the second backing plate, between the second backing plate and third backing plate and between third backing plate and outlet.The present invention can carry out classification to peanut of different sizes and peel off, and save the operation of the screening before peeling off, do not need to peel off in batches, also, can continuously feed, significantly improve production efficiency.

A kind of earthnut sheller with grading function
Technical field
The invention belongs to mechanical equipment technical fields, and in particular to a kind of earthnut sheller with grading function.
Background technique
Existing earthnut sheller is usually that peanut of different sizes is added simultaneously to peel off in container, passes through rubbing, strike It peels off with being realized the effects of extruding, for example, CN205624332 discloses a kind of earthnut sheller, by two breaker rolls to flower Life is tentatively squeezed, and peanut shell is occurred damaged, is then crumpled using the speed difference between conveyer belt to peanut, Peanut grain is rubbed, and finally sifts out shelled peanut under the action of oscillating screen plate.
But above-mentioned patent is since the distance between conveyer belt is certain, when bulky grain peanut is between cascading conveyors, Peanut grain can be rubbed, but peanut lesser for particle, can not be contacted with upper layer conveyer belt, and peanut grain can not then be rubbed with the hands Out, and if the distance between conveyer belt is suitable for the lesser peanut of particle, bulky grain peanut then be can not be successfully into upper Between lower conveyor belt, even if being able to enter, it can also cause peanut grain damaged during rubbing.To guarantee peel off effect and matter Amount, should sieve peanut of different sizes before peeling off, peel off in batches, and this adds increased steps of peeling off, and reduce life Efficiency is produced, therefore, it is necessary to provide a kind of decorticator that can be carried out classification to peanut and peel off.
Summary of the invention
It is an object of the invention to: aiming at the problem that above-mentioned existing earthnut sheller can not carry out peanut to be classified and peel off, The present invention provides a kind of earthnut sheller with grading function.
The technical solution adopted by the invention is as follows:
A kind of earthnut sheller with grading function, including shell, it is horizontal in the shell to be equipped with for placing peanut Conveyer belt, shell side are equipped with the entrance passed through for conveyer belt, and the other side is equipped with the outlet passed through for conveyer belt, the biography Sending band is filter structure;Direction of the lower surface of conveyer belt from entrance to outlet is equipped at intervals with the first backing plate, the second backing plate and Three backing plates, being equipped with above conveyer belt can move up and down and rotatable first pressing plate, the second pressing plate and third pressing plate, and described first Pressing plate, the second pressing plate and third pressing plate are corresponded with the first backing plate, the second backing plate and third backing plate respectively;First backing plate and Rewinding is equipped with below conveyer belt between two backing plates, between the second backing plate and third backing plate and between third backing plate and outlet Box.
When the invention works, peanut of different sizes is placed on conveyer belt together, conveyer belt send peanut to first At backing plate, the first pressing plate of control is displaced downwardly to appropriate location, and the first pressing plate peanut shell coarse with particle contacts at this time, then controls The first press plate rotary is made, to carry out attrition crushing to bulky grain peanut shell, conveyer belt works on, what completion was tentatively peeled off Peanut is transported between the first backing plate and the second backing plate, since conveyer belt is filter structure, at this point, big grain shelled peanut is passed through and passed Band is sent to fall into rewinding box.And broken peanut shell and the lesser peanut of particle is sent at the second backing plate, the second pressure of control Plate is displaced downwardly to appropriate location, and controls its rotation, can peanut shell to moderate size carry out attrition crushing, similarly, pass Band is sent to be passed between the second backing plate and third backing plate, middle grain shelled peanut is then fallen into rewinding box, and subsequent process is same as above, third Pressing plate carries out attrition crushing to the shell of little particle peanut, finally available granule shelled peanut, and all broken peanut shells are then It is discharged by conveyer belt through outlet.The present invention can carry out classification to peanut of different sizes and peel off, and save the behaviour of the screening before peeling off Make, does not need to peel off in batches, also, can continuously feed, significantly improve production efficiency.In addition, not due to shelled peanut The space in peanut shell can be filled up, that is to say, that horizontal positioned peanut, between existing centainly between shelled peanut and top shell Gap controls the first pressing plate, the second pressing plate and third pressing plate respectively and is displaced downwardly to appropriate location according to the specification of peanut, that is, can avoid It is contacted with shelled peanut, significantly reduces the damage during peeling off to shelled peanut, guarantee final product quality.
Further, between the first backing plate and the second backing plate, between the second backing plate and third backing plate and third backing plate and Telescopic rod is equipped with above conveyer belt between outlet vertically, the bottom end of telescopic rod is equipped with the ball that can be contacted with conveyer belt. Telescopic rod stretches repeatedly, so that ball be driven continuously to beat to conveyer belt, guarantees that shelled peanut can smoothly be fallen into In rewinding box.
Further, case top is equipped with the first motor being sequentially connected with telescopic rod.
Further, the first pressing plate, the second pressing plate and third pressing plate pass through connecting rod and are connected with cylinder.Pass through cylinder band Dynamic connecting rod moves up and down, so that the first pressing plate, the second pressing plate and third pressing plate be driven to move up and down respectively.
Further, the bottom end of connecting rod is equipped with connecting plate, and the second motor, the first pressing plate, the second pressure are equipped in connecting plate Plate and third pressing plate pass through bull stick and connect with the second motor.By the way that connecting plate is arranged in the bottom of connecting rod, and in connecting plate Interior setting controls the second motor of the first pressing plate, the second pressing plate and third press plate rotary respectively, so that the first pressing plate, the second pressing plate It can both move up and down with third pressing plate, can also have been rotated after moving down.
Further, sieve is equipped in rewinding box.During peeling off, thinner peanut shell inevitably will form, this A little thin peanut shells follow shelled peanut to fall into rewinding box, therefore sieve is arranged in rewinding box, and thin peanut shell is then fallen across sieve Enter rewinding box bottom, shelled peanut is then located on sieve.
Further, the first backing plate, the second backing plate and third backing plate pass through support column and housing bottom is fixed.
In conclusion by adopting the above-described technical solution, the beneficial effects of the present invention are:
It peels off 1. the present invention can carry out classification to peanut of different sizes, saves the operation of the screening before peeling off, do not need point It criticizes and peels off, also, can continuously feed, significantly improve production efficiency;
2. the present invention controls the first pressing plate, the second pressing plate and third pressing plate respectively and is displaced downwardly to suitably according to the specification of peanut Position can avoid contacting with shelled peanut, significantly reduce the damage during peeling off to shelled peanut, guarantees final product quality.
